New Iowa Bill Would Revoke Funding for Library Affiliation with the American Library Association

Iowa public libraries may lose access to state funds for being affiliated by the American Library Association under a new anti-library bill floated by state republicans. Continue reading >>

NYT: Penguin to extend ebook and audiobook library rentals to LA and Cleveland

Penguin will refresh its ebook lending system later today, according to a report from the New York Times. The publisher will start lending out its titles in Los Angeles and Cleveland, mimicking the program that trialled (despite some DRM issues) in New York. Public library users can even expect...
